About Thomas Widiez

Thomas Widiez is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ology, Biotechnology, Genetics and Computer Networks and Communications, having authored 27 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Molecular Biology Research (10 papers), Plant Reproductive Biology (9 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(6 papers), Chromosomal and Genetic Variations (6 papers), Plant tissue culture and regeneration (6 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(4 papers), C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(4 papers) and Plant Surface Properties and Treatments (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Plant Science (1.1k citations), Molecular Biology (757 citations), Biotechnology (55 citations), Genetics (149 citations) and Agronomy and Crop Science (47 citations). Thomas Widiez has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Peter Rogowsky, Nicolas M. Doll, Laurine Gilles, Jean‐Pierre Martinant, Nathalie Depège‐Fargeix, Gwyneth Ingram, Marc Lepetit, Alaín Gojon, Thomas Girin and Ghislaine Gendrot. Their work appears in journals such as The Plant Cell, Current Biology, The Plant Journal, Plant Cell Reports and Frontiers in Plant Science.
